The Person Behind Harmony Rising 

Harmony Rising - the name, it's simple, it involves food like most things in Ellen's life. When baked goods, bread especially, come out of the oven they make a faint, yet harmonious sound. All these ingredients rise together to make one delicious creation...that's Harmony Rising. 

Working in kitchens has been Ellen's life passion since she was a wee youngin'. It has always been a happy place for her. Growing up she spent most of her time in the kitchen with her mom, watching her every move. Her mother has this amazing ability to make anyone feel comforted with food...and a hug. Naturally, Ellen wanted to be just like her. 

So off she went to the Culinary Institute of America in Hyde Park, NY where she graduated with an associate's degree in Baking and Pastry Arts and a bachelor's degree in Hospitality Business Management.  She worked in the West Loop of Chicago for Chef Stephanie Izard and BOKA Restaurant Group for seven years and held several different positions. After an injury, Ellen took a break from the back of the house (the kitchen). In the fall of 2021, Ellen said goodbye to her home in the West Loop. 

As creating delicious food is still Ellen's passion starting a small business in the form of a micro bakery at home is her way of keeping that passion for food alive and the "knead" for dough in her life.
